Dorchester, a diverse and bustling neighborhood in Suffolk County, MA, is known for its rich cultural heritage and vibrant community life. The area boasts a variety of attractions, including the beautiful Franklin Park with its zoo and golf course, and the historic JFK Presidential Library and Museum. Residents enjoy an array of dining options, ranging from local eateries to international cuisine. The district provides excellent public transportation options, with several MBTA Red Line stops and easy access to major highways, making commuting throughout the Greater Boston area convenient and efficient.
